Course Description
Production of sculpture in refractory molds and sand casting, both representational and non-representational, with emphasis on aesthetic development and mixed media.

Course Objectives
This course is a continuation of the development of the thinking and expertise acquired in ARST 3440. More diverse problem solving is emphasized. Skill acquisition is enhanced. Various approaches to metal casting and working are emphasized. Assessment of overall accomplishments is formulated during intense discussion at studio critiques occurring regularly throughout the semester. Students and instructor interact as a group during these critiques.
Topical Outline
Three or more sculptures are required in this level.
